Output ec60fe6960a8520c5a5b0c336a36e17544050e42ad200688b678ea2ec3d6357d:0

value
7421269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a7a2537fb834ffd46a465ce3e0b0dfcbba55e9 OP_EQUAL
address
3FWtmvw3q5VNbwwDvdCSn5A3VQF84gCxsK
transaction
ec60fe6960a8520c5a5b0c336a36e17544050e42ad200688b678ea2ec3d6357d
spent
true